Despite global efforts to tackle slavery and eliminate all forms of servitude in modern society, the centuries-old practice continues to metamorphose assuming more sophisticated, dangerous and brazen trend dividing the global community on ethnicity and region as it did hundreds of years back.

While slavery has long been entrenched in numerous societies world over since time immemorial, the 15th century Trans-Atlantic trade that saw up to 12 million slaves most of them from West Africa hounded into ships and transported to Europe and Americas to work in tobacco and cotton farms, has had the biggest and most devastating impact on especially Africa and altered global politics and relations.

From Cape Verde where Portuguese merchants set up their first slavery hub and actively advanced the sale and buying of black slaves for centuries, to the less discussed but equally key Barbary slave trade in North Africa and the East African Muslim Arabs-dominated slavery where young men and women were forcefully taken to the Middle East through the Sahara Desert and the Indian Ocean, serfdom has since its embryonic phase robbed Africans some of its most able and healthiest men and women.

This dossier takes a different approach to the dominant conversation on slavery that often lean on imperialism. We seek to trace the history of slavery from the perspective of those who were affected by it and tell their stories through millions of their descendants who were robbed off their heritage, culture, identity.
